Summary
Meiwa Industries, in collaboration with Takasago Thermal Engineering and Panasonic Electric Works, has initiated a trial operation of a hydrogen storage system powered by solar carports. The system generates hydrogen through water electrolysis using solar energy, stores it in tanks, and converts it back to electricity via Panasonic fuel cells. Conducted at Meiwa’s rental factory in Niigata City, the trial aims to assess hydrogen’s viability as an alternative to traditional batteries, particularly for utilizing surplus solar power during non-operational periods. This initiative aligns with global efforts to promote hydrogen as a sustainable energy source, with Japan actively advancing hydrogen strategies and infrastructure development.
